Course content


• Understanding the Demographic Changes in an Aging Population •
• Health Promotion and Disease Prevention Strategies for Older Adults •
• Nutrition and Hydration for Older People •
• Managing Chronic Conditions in Older Adults •
• Fall Prevention and Management in Older Adults •
• Mental Health and Wellbeing in Older People •
• Social Isolation and Loneliness in Older Adults •
• Care Planning and Coordination for Older People •
• Palliative Care for Older Adults with Advanced Illness •
• Ageism and Discrimination in Healthcare Settings
